Additions

  • The Festival Grounds are now open for seasonal events! Throughout the season and every other week, the Festival Grounds opens for players to be able to play games every day and earn seasonal coins. This can help get some rare items needed for Collections or to resell in your Flea Market shop! We're currently in Summer, so you can experience the Midsummer games until Autumn.
  • You will now see Hints on every page that may need explanation, including games or tasks, tying into the Getting Started Guide. If you want to reset these after dismissing, you can re-enable them in your Account Settings.
  • You can now Wire Transfer money to any other player in Riverton from the Central Bank.

Adjustments

  • Your recipes are no longer consumed when you make something in your Kitchen. The Recipes are consumed upon learning it, but once learned, you can cook the Recipe as many times as you want without needing the Recipe item in your inventory! Thank you to everyone who has given feedback about this.
  • The Job Agency will now give out jobs for Common or Very Common items only. Thank you to everyone who reported this bug as the amount of items have increased!
  • Experience is now reflective of how many batches you complete in the Workshop and Food Processor.
  • The Fishing timer should no longer show negative minutes when waiting.
  • Orchard and Farms should now be consistent with which plots are given fertilizer after paying for it.
  • Livestock should now be able to be handled after a competition.
  • Made some visual changes across the site to provide some continuity and consistency.
  • Restored missing locations to the Map list of locations. (Thank you, ZarraMoon!)
